Really nice finds and great advice, Ryan. In your opinion, does it make any difference in discriminating out the iron or running all metal and turning the iron volume way down?
@rdoggtreasurehunter55836 ай бұрын
I haven't tried turning it down, I think having iron on changes the way some good tones sound, so I disc. it all out. Cheers!

Hi RDogg. I was wondering if you could give me some advice on what the best carrying bag is for holding your tools as well as your finds as your detecting. I find my current one cumbersome and things fall out of the finds pouch. Any ideas would be greatly appreciated.
@rdoggtreasurehunter55836 ай бұрын
Cheers Doreen, I like the thin Garrett pouch. I put my digger, pinpointer and trash in the large pocket, and it has a small zipper pocket for the finds. It is not bulky, light and it is very well priced, around 20$ or less. All the best!
